EPIC GAMES, INC., Plaintiff, v. APPLE INC., Defendant Case No. 20-cv-05640-YGR (TSH) United States District Court, N.D. California Filed May 15, 2025 Hixson, Thomas S., United States Magistrate Judge DISCOVERY ORDER The parties have filed many objections to the Special Masters’ privilege determinations and related motions to seal. The Court rules on a number of them as follows. A. ECF 1191 (Epic’s Objections) The parties have made literally hundreds of filings related to their objections to the Special Masters’ determinations. In an attempt to facilitate review of these filings, the Court ordered the parties to lodge hard copies. ECF No. 1468. The Court’s order specified certain information to be provided, but then included a catch all request: “If there are any other items the Court should consider in ruling on the objection (such as another filing that states a dispute has been narrowed or resolved), those shall be included in succeeding lettered tabs.” For ECF No. 1191, the Court ruled on most of Epic’s objections already, but ordered Apple to resubmit Entries 2522-2527 and 665. One thing the Court should consider in ruling on Epic’s objections concerning those Entries is Apple’s resubmission of those exhibits. Yet there is nothing in the hard copy submission that tells the Court where to look to find those items. The Court therefore OVERRULES Epic’s objections with respect to those Entries for failure to comply with the Court’s order at ECF No. 1468.
